Retrieved from http://www.jstor.org/action/showPublication?journalCode=chilyoutenvi Abstract Play is an integral part of young children’s physical and cognitive development. Outdoor play has been shown to have numerous physical and mental benefits for children. The Partners through Playgrounds program was a collaborative effort among university, Head Start, and community members to transform a traditional playground into a natural playscape. This program demonstrates the ability of a community to transform a playground on limited funding. Donations, volunteerism, and a strong community presence were major components in the renovation. The purpose of this report is to illustrate strategies and community efforts to improve young children’s outdoor environments. Impetus for the Program For at least 9 years, I (the lead author) had been working primarily on professional development with the teachers at the Head Start center where the current program took place. As I traveled back and forth between my office at the university and the low-income housing development where the Head Start center was located, I became increasingly aware of the big differences between the Head Start children’s outdoor play activities and play spaces and those of the children at our university center. My focus began to shift to the rights of all young children to have beautiful, engaging, and safe spaces to learn and play, both inside and outside. I thought about the ways the ELC outdoor spaces had transformed from a typical swings-and-slides playground into one rich in natural play areas that included mini- forests for hide-and-seek, a wooden gazebo to shelter children from the hot southern sun, and large “walking logs,” and gave children opportunities to tend and harvest the beautiful flower and vegetable gardens. At Head Start, however, the playground had no shade and included metal swings, slides, a balance beam and stationary riding toys that had become stuck in the deep mulch underfoot (Figure 1). The dominant activity among Head Start children was to race up and down one side of the playground. The comparison of the two outdoor spaces and the children’s play patterns could not have been starker. I started to wonder what could be done to change the Head Start playground when a university Outreach and Engagement call for proposals was posted. Proposals were to include evidence of building upon already strong university-community partnerships through the creation of new initiatives funded through small grants. I wondered if we could find a way to create a beautiful, natural playground for the more than 100 preschool children who attended the Head Start center and learn how these changes would impact children’s activity levels and play. Over the next six months with $2,000 from our successful proposal, we used our experience of the university playground renovation to inspire and guide the installation of a natural playground designed with our Head Start partners. Stationary riding toys and seesaw stuck in mulch at the original Head Start center playground Our introduction of building a natural playground was initially met with mixed responses from our Head Start partners. Immediately, concerns about whether these new materials would pass state child care licensure safety standards were voiced. In particular, we discussed both “fall zones” and “use zones” that addressed safety measures for structures from which children could fall. We discussed how our university school staff had worked with local licensure offices to address similar concerns. Then, we made plans to bring Head Start administrators to our university playground to see a natural playground in action. On the day of the visit to the ELC’s natural playground, we walked together among the trees, plantings, boulders, and log structures and slowly began to imagine what could be installed on the Head Start playground. Our partners returned to Head Start with an “inspiration book” created by the ELC teachers that included various photographs of natural playgrounds, park areas, and back yards to identify the elements that they most wanted to install. They spent time pouring over the pages and tagging the elements they felt were the best to provide the Head Start children. Goals and Context of the Project In setting out to redesign the outdoor play space at Head Start, the team considered what we knew from research about the value of these spaces for children’s play, learning, and well-being. As described above, the Head Start playground was a relatively small, fenced-in space that included traditional playground equipment, small open areas of grass and mulch, and no shade. The university team, led by Dawn P. Coe and made up of faculty members and students from the Child and Family Studies department and the Kinesiology, Recreation, and Sport Studies department, aimed to not only transform the outdoor space to benefit the children’s play and health, but also to investigate how the changes led to Partners through Playgrounds: Building a Play Community 156 observable differences in children’s use of the space. The benefits of physical activity for young children are well established, including positive weight status, mental health, social, and emotional outcomes, as well as school readiness indicators (Timmons et al., 2012). Recent Institute of Medicine recommendations suggest that childcare settings offer daily opportunities for children to accumulate at least 15 minutes per hour of physical activity, which includes light-, moderate-, and vigorous-intensity activities (Institute of Medicine, 2011). The majority of 3- and 4-year-old children are enrolled in preschool or childcare programs (OECD, 2012). Therefore, these environments have the potential to be an ideal setting for providing physical activity opportunities. This is particularly important for programs that serve at-risk children as these children often experience disproportionately high levels of obesity and poorer health outcomes. We were interested, therefore, in studying playground modifications in a Head Start program, since it is a federally funded program providing educational, physical, social, and emotional support services to nearly one million young children and their families in the U.S. each year. Outdoor playtime on playgrounds is a critical time for young children to engage in physical activity. The majority of care and school settings for young children typically feature a playground for outdoor play and recess. Natural playgrounds are gaining popularity in early childhood programs (Little, Elliott & Wyver, 2017; Masiulanis & Cummins, 2017; Moore & Cosco, 2012; Nelson, 2012; Rivkin & Schein, 2014). These are typically inspired by features occurring naturally in green spaces and forest areas that include logs, boulders, creek beds, garden areas, and may contain a variety of loose parts for open-ended play. The incorporation of natural elements in playgrounds has been found to have a positive influence on children’s motor skill development (Fjørtoft, 2001) and physical activity (Coe, Flynn, Wolff, Durham, & Scott, 2014), as well as cooperative and constructive play behaviors (Kuh, Ponte, & Chau, 2013). Although the benefits of exposure to natural features and engagement on natural playgrounds is well documented, little work has been done to add these features to most playgrounds at child care centers in the U.S. Informed with this broad view of the potential for natural playgrounds to support both the health and play possibilities for children, the university team initiated pre- intervention data collection and observations of children’s play. We needed to collect pre/post data in order to observe how the children’s play might be characterized differently after the installation of natural elements on the playground. Our approach involved collecting data on physical activity levels using accelerometers. Additionally, we used direct observation to describe activity behaviors [Observational System for Recording Activity in Children – Preschool, OSRAC-P (Brown et al., 2006)] and play behaviors [Play Observation Scale (Rubin, 2001)]. Meanwhile, the Head Start leaders and the university team met several times between April and June, 2014 to create a vision for the playground transformation. This involved mapping out possibilities to create new elements and replacing existing elements with natural options. The emerging plan took shape as a hybrid of conventional and natural playground designs. The Head Start team identified which Partners through Playgrounds: Building a Play Community 157 elements would remain, including a swing set, a climber with slides, and a small water table (Figure 2). These were viewed as indispensable parts of the existing playground and ones that children used frequently. Other, less-frequently used elements were identified for removal, including chin-up bars, spring rocking toys, and a seesaw. We planned new natural elements based on the team’s prior inspiration from visiting the ELC playground and looking over photos from other playgrounds. The wish list included walking logs, tree stumps, and boulders (Figures 3 and 4). All of these elements would ultimately be included in the new natural playground along with a dry rock creek bed and boxed gardens, a small walking bridge, and a gazebo and trees for much needed shade. The final options were determined through an emerging process of collaboration, community involvement, and feasibility for the space. Figure 2. Natural materials added to the Head Start center playground Transformation of the Playground The Partners Through Playgrounds team brainstormed possible programs, businesses, city and UTK departments that might be able to provide in-kind donations or services. Several partners were recruited to assist with the installation of the new elements, donations of materials, and volunteer support. Securing donated services and materials was one of the aspects of this program that worked especially well. Table 1 lists the multiple organizations and contributions made towards the project. Timing was also on our side, as the City of Knoxville’s Department of Urban Forestry had three large trees scheduled for removal at about the same time of the installation and they were able to donate Partners through Playgrounds: Building a Play Community 159 and deliver the tree trunks to the site. Additionally, we visited a local mulch and rock supplier to select boulders and river rocks and purchased these at a discounted price. In both cases the Forestry Office staff and mulch and rock business owner agreed to transport these items to the center at no cost. The ELC donated 12 bags of organic soil, and trays of plants were donated by Americorps for the new six garden boxes. Wood to make the boxes, dividers to separate plants, and plants, including some flowers, fruits and fruits and vegetables (i.e. tomatoes, strawberries and peppers) were also purchased and planted. Lastly, a Bobcat and Bobcat operator were loaned to the project from the area Community Development Corporation at no cost. Installation of the playground took place over two days, on June 7 and 8, 2014. Prior to the installation weekend, tree limbs and stumps, and boulders and river rocks were delivered to the Head Start center. On the first day, old playground equipment was extracted using the Bobcat and a truck, and new natural playground elements were placed. The Bobcat was used to excavate long shallow ditches for imbedding walking logs, digging shallow holes for tree stumps, settling boulders so they would not roll, and placing the heavy objects. Several groups of that included 40 volunteers from a local community college, Americorps, Community Development Corporation, UTK, and Head Start contributed in a multitude of ways by (1) helping navigate and place large playground elements, such as shifting walking logs, pushing boulders, and digging holes; (2) repainting and reinstalling preexisting playground equipment (i.e., swing set and water and sand table); (3) building and filling the garden boxes; and (4) placing river rocks to create the dry creek bed (Figure 5). Figure 5. Garden boxes and dry creek bed built at the Head Start center Partners through Playgrounds: Building a Play Community 160 While the majority of the playground transformation was completed over a single weekend, several additional elements were installed afterward. For example, three months later, a pergola was added to provide children with shade. Additionally, later in the fall, the City arborist returned with a gift of six medium-sized, young shade trees. While a great deal of work was completed over a very short time frame, many pieces of the puzzle had to fall into place on installation weekend to ensure projects could be completed and the best possible use of volunteer services and labor were utilized. Some critical moments of the project involved the coordination of volunteers, donated services, and materials. For example, the removal of some of the existing equipment and the placement of the new equipment needed to be synced over the course of two weekend days so as not to interrupt the playground use by the children during the week. The intensity of the coordination effort was matched with high levels of enthusiasm by all those volunteering and coordinating the installation. In 2016-17 the staff of a second Head Start center located across town next to a city greenway began to clear ground on their traditional playground. Now, children take care of berry patches and flowers and vegetables, ride trikes along a circular mulched path that encircles a centrally located dirt “hill,” and balance on walking logs and boulders. During the 2017-18 year the staff and administration of a third center, situated on a partially cleared hill adjacent to woods, transformed their hilly and sparse playground to include much-needed shade, a flattened area for a new bike trail, large rocks, walking logs, a new water spigot for making mud pies. Graduate students in the UTK Child and Family Studies Department raised $130.00 through a campus popsicle fund-raiser to pay for the creation of a highly desired children’s “mud kitchen.” Project Summary Partners Through Playgrounds was able to accomplish three over-arching aims. Implications The Partners Through Playgrounds program illustrates a community-based effort to bring about changes in the environment that have the potential to positively influence the learning and development of young children. With limited funding, the Partners Through Playgrounds team and community partners were able to join forces to provide Head Start children with a renovated play space that included natural elements. This playground transformation can be used to enhance not only the physical activity and play behaviors among children, but also expand upon the preschool curriculum. For example, the addition of garden spaces can be used to cultivate reading, math, and science skills (Vandermaas-Peeler & McClain, 2015). Implementing these types of changes in the outdoor environment can be very cost- effective through the solicitation of donations, community partners, and hard work by all involved. Creating functional outdoor spaces in which children can play and learn will enrich their preschool experience and their physical and cognitive development (Gill, 2014). Planning committees for these renovations should take into account the current environment, the needs of the facility, the age and interests of the children, and the funding/community partnerships available. These factors were instrumental in the creation of the Partners Through Playgrounds program and the success of the playground renovation.
